Gadino Cellars is a small winery in Washington, Virginia, focused on producing over 14 types of fine wines including Italian varietals from their own vineyard, emphasizing sustainability and family tradition. Visitors relax in a spacious modern Tuscan tasting room or on a sun-splashed deck overlooking the vineyards and Blue Ridge Mountains. They offer bocce courts, are pet-friendly, and partner for boxed lunches.
